Since the string stores an array of characters, just like arrays the position of each character is represented by an index (starting from 0). If you try to access the character of a String at the index is either negative or greater than the size of the string, a StringIndexOutOfBoundsException is thrown. For some methods such as the java substring, charAt method, this exception also is thrown when the index is equal to the size of the string.

How to solve the StringIndexOutOfBoundsException

  • Check the length of the string before using substring()
  • Exception handling using try...catch.
